Hanmantwadi
Hanmantwadi is a village located in Chakur tehsil of Latur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Chakur (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Latur. As per 2009 stats, Tirthawadi is the gram panchayat of Hanmantwadi village.

About Hanmantwadi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Hanmantwadi is 560509. The village spans a total geographical area of 312.56 hectares. Latur is nearest town to Hanmantwadi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 36km away.

Population of Hanmantwadi
Below is a concise population overview of Hanmantwadi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 793 | 414 | 379 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 127 | 62 | 65 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 110 | 60 | 50 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 411 | 265 | 146 |
Illiterate Population | 382 | 149 | 233 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Hanmantwadi village:
- The total population of Hanmantwadi village is around 793, including approximately 414 males and 379 females, with a sex ratio of 915 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 127 children aged 0–6 years in Hanmantwadi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Hanmantwadi village has 110 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Hanmantwadi village is about 51.83%, with male literacy at 64.01% and female literacy at 38.52%.
- There are around 143 households in Hanmantwadi village.
Connectivity of Hanmantwadi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Hanmantwadi. As per the 2011 stats, Hanmantwadi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
